#

Site Supply Chain Manager

SIRE Life Sciences®

Netherlands, zagranica

SIRE Life Sciences®

Site Supply Chain Manager

Location: Netherlands

SIRE Life Sciences® is the market leader in life science recruitment. We believe the recruitment market needs to gear up in technology and continues innovation. We like technology, in a life science market driven on science, we couldn’t stay behind; we drive Recruitment Science. Investing a majority of our turnover in technology enables us to use unique Resource Technologies. By using highly advanced algorithms, we enable our team of Resource & Data Strategists© to maintain the most advanced, detailed and complete Life Sciences network in Europe. This big data enables us to work Reverse Recruitment©: we first analyze the market in-depth before we go out to the market. Because we analyze the whole market, we can compare facts and data. This enables us to do Facts & Big Data Recruitment©, making sure we, or better yet, you find the right career!

THE COMPANY

Our client is a professional Chemicals organization, based in Noord-Brabant Netherlands.

Fortune 500 company headquartered in the United States with 20.000+ FTE worldwide.

ROLE DESCRIPTION

In order to achieve an undisturbed and efficient sales and production process the Site Supply Chain Manager coordinates the Supply Chain department from the monthly rolling forecast to the production lines capacity and material availability.

The Supply Chain Manager is accountable for the complete supply chain including procurement and transportation. Accountable for logistics (storage and expedition), customer service (sales support, pricing and complaint handling), production planning, rolling forecast, shipments and procurement. This person will provide leadership and coaching to the local teams and be part of the Site Management Team. The SCM reports to the Site Manager and has 4 direct- and 11 indirect reports.

RESPONSIBILITIES

- Accountable for the performance and results of the supply chain teams and responsible for departmental budgets.
- Takes ownership for the complete supply chain including monthly rolling forecast.
- Evaluates, recommends and implements inventory management and forecasting solutions.
- Develops and maintains relationships with customers in order to improve efficiency and reduce costs.
- Takes responsibility for managing customer requirements and achieving total customer satisfaction.
- Accountable for the day-to-day stock control and the reliability of stock levels on the database.
- Accountable for all customer service related issues; sales support, coordination of pricing procedures and complaint handling.
- Manage and coordinate procurement department.
- Manages all custom matters and incoterms.
- Produces the rolling forecasts and takes accountability for resources planning for Operations.
- Ensures full compliance and application of all legal, environmental, organizational and technical requirements.
- Responsible to find root cause and fix customer complaints related to his department.

REQUIREMENTS

- Bachelor degree in Supply Chain, Logistics, Engineering, Economics or another related field
- Min. 7 years Supply Chain experience in a manufacturing environment with dynamic demand
- Excellent English language skills
- Proven Change Leader
- Continuous improvement mindset
- Advanced Supply- and Demand Planning knowledge
- Experience dealing with demanding customers
- Key competences: Vision, Leadership, Customer focus, Result orientation, Analytical capacity, Persuasion and Influence

Are you interested and do want to apply for this role, please fill out your application via the apply button below and contact Jonas Houweling.

Prosimy o aplikowanie poprzez przycisk znajdujący się po prawej stronie ogłoszenia.
SIRE Life Sciences®

Czy chcesz otrzymywać oferty pracy na podobne stanowiska?

Utwórz powiadomienie e-mail
Zapisz mnie

Zapisani kandydaci otrzymują informacje jako pierwsi.

Podziel się ze znajomymi